Output 58296f077a364ed1e52921f24076343a67a6d64e67c1b167bfc92e4a47ce2019:1

value
62756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 259ccadd4821f73e3e17b54073ef91ab34d8b5ef OP_EQUALVERIFY OP_CHECKSIG
address
14RsqEBtKSdSTC9W7GVCubigQCPfbWNuCD
transaction
58296f077a364ed1e52921f24076343a67a6d64e67c1b167bfc92e4a47ce2019
spent
true